跳到主要內容

快速入門

安裝遇到困難?
  • 點擊加入 中文社區微信群,提問並獲取群內專家幫助。
  • 如果您已經安裝了龍蝦 OpenClaw,或者國內常見的龍蝦版本,例如 QClaw、WorkBuddy、ArkClaw、AutoClaw,可以讓它讀文檔協助您配置,您自己不用懂任何技術細節。有兩種方式:
    • 方式一(最簡單):把中文社區網址 https://hermesagent.org.cn 發給它,讓它自己訪問並閱讀文檔。

    • 方式二(更精準,推薦):直接把下面這段話複製發給您的 Agent,它會自己完成配置:

      請把這個 MCP server 加到你的配置裡:https://mcp.hermesagent.org.cn/v1 (Streamable HTTP,無需 API Key、無需登錄)。加完後用它幫我查 Hermes Agent 中文文檔來指導我完成安裝。
    • 方式二配好後,Agent 就能按關鍵詞直接檢索並讀取 113 篇中文文檔的全文。

  • 安裝過程中遇到問題時,也可以先詢問 豆包DeepSeek 等 AI 助手。

本指南將引導你完成安裝 Hermes Agent、配置大模型提供商,並與 Hermes Agent進行首次對話。

1. 安裝 Hermes Agent

類 Linux / macOS / WSL2

curl -fsSL https://res1.hermesagent.org.cn/install.sh | bash

Windows 原生 PowerShell

irm https://res1.hermesagent.org.cn/install.ps1 | iex
什麼是 PowerShell?怎麼打開?
  • PowerShell 是 Windows 自帶的命令行程序,可以理解成“Windows 裡的終端”。
  • 打開方式:按一下鍵盤左下角 Windows 鍵,輸入 PowerShell,然後點擊 Windows PowerShellPowerShell
  • 如果你看到的是 Windows Terminal 也沒關係,只要裡面開的標籤頁是 PowerShell 即可。
  • 不要把上面的命令粘貼到瀏覽器地址欄、資源管理器地址欄,或“運行”對話框裡。
Windows 用戶
  • 最推薦:先安裝 WSL2,再在 WSL2 終端裡運行上面的 install.sh
  • 想直接在 PowerShell 裡安裝:運行上面的 install.ps1
  • WSL2 是什麼? 可以把它理解成“Windows 裡的 Linux 終端環境”。裝好以後,你可以在 Windows 電腦上直接打開 Ubuntu 終端,按 Linux 的方式安裝和運行 Hermes Agent。
  • 詳細說明請看 Windows 安裝指南
中國大陸網絡環境提示

當前頁的一鍵安裝命令已經由 Hermes Agent 中文社區 提供 國內鏡像加速,默認優先走國內可直連鏈路。

為了提高中國大陸用戶的安裝體驗,鏡像版安裝器默認精簡了部分國人不常用、或體積較大且經常受外網影響的可選功能,例如瀏覽器自動化、Chromium 下載、WhatsApp 橋接等。建議先完成核心安裝,確認 Hermes Agent 可以正常運行;之後可讓 Hermes Agent 自身補全這些能力。

如果你需要繼續處理 WSL 網絡、終端代理或手動鏡像配置,可參考:

安裝完成後:

類 Unix / WSL2

source ~/.bashrc   # 或:source ~/.zshrc

Windows PowerShell

# 關閉並重新打開 PowerShell 即可

如果你是第一次接觸 Windows 命令行,建議直接繼續看 Windows 安裝指南,裡面把:

  • 什麼是 PowerShell
  • 怎麼打開 PowerShell
  • 什麼時候需要管理員 PowerShell
  • PowerShell 直裝的完整步驟

都拆開寫了。

2. 配置大模型提供商

安裝程序會自動為你配置 LLM 提供商。如需後續更改,可使用以下任一命令:

hermes model       # 選擇大語言模型提供商和模型
hermes tools # 配置啟用哪些工具
hermes setup # 或一次性完成全部配置

hermes model 會引導你選擇推理提供者:

提供者是什麼如何配置
Nous Portal基於訂閱、零配置通過 hermes model 進行 OAuth 登錄
OpenAI CodexChatGPT OAuth,使用 Codex 模型通過 hermes model 進行設備碼認證
Anthropic直接使用 Claude 模型(Pro/Max 或 API 密鑰)使用 hermes model 進行 Claude Code 認證,或提供 Anthropic API 密鑰
OpenRouter跨多種模型的多提供者路由輸入你的 API 密鑰
Z.AIGLM / Zhipu 託管模型設置 GLM_API_KEY / ZAI_API_KEY
Kimi / MoonshotMoonshot 託管的代碼與聊天模型設置 KIMI_API_KEY
MiniMax國際 MiniMax 接口設置 MINIMAX_API_KEY
MiniMax 中國區中國區域 MiniMax 接口設置 MINIMAX_CN_API_KEY
阿里雲通過 DashScope 使用 Qwen 模型設置 DASHSCOPE_API_KEY
Hugging Face通過統一路由使用 20+ 開源模型(Qwen、DeepSeek、Kimi 等)設置 HF_TOKEN
Kilo CodeKiloCode 託管模型設置 KILOCODE_API_KEY
OpenCode Zen按使用量付費訪問精選模型設置 OPENCODE_ZEN_API_KEY
OpenCode Go每月 $10 訂閱,訪問開源模型設置 OPENCODE_GO_API_KEY
DeepSeek直接訪問 DeepSeek API設置 DEEPSEEK_API_KEY
GitHub CopilotGitHub Copilot 訂閱(GPT-5.x、Claude、Gemini 等)通過 hermes model 進行 OAuth,或設置 COPILOT_GITHUB_TOKEN / GH_TOKEN
GitHub Copilot ACPCopilot ACP Agent 後端(啟動本地 copilot CLI)使用 hermes model(需安裝 copilot CLI 並執行 copilot login
Vercel AI GatewayVercel AI Gateway 路由設置 AI_GATEWAY_API_KEY
自定義端點VLLM、SGLang、Ollama 或任何 OpenAI 兼容 API設置基礎 URL + API 密鑰
提示

你可以隨時通過 hermes model 切換提供者——無需修改代碼,無鎖定風險。配置自定義端點時,Hermes 會提示你輸入上下文窗口大小,並在可能的情況下自動檢測。詳情請參見 上下文長度檢測

3. 開始對話

hermes

完成!你將看到包含模型信息、可用工具和技能的歡迎橫幅。輸入消息並按 Enter 鍵。

❯ 你現在能幫我做什麼?

該 Agent 已具備訪問網絡搜索、文件操作、終端命令等工具的能力——開箱即用。

4. 嘗試核心功能

讓它使用終端

❯ 幫我看看磁盤空間佔用情況,並列出最大的 5 個目錄。

Agent 將代表你執行終端命令,並顯示結果。

使用斜槓命令

輸入 / 可查看所有命令的自動補全下拉菜單:

命令功能
/help顯示所有可用命令
/tools列出可用工具
/model交互式切換模型
/personality pirate嘗試有趣的個性模式
/save保存對話

多行輸入

Alt+EnterCtrl+J 可換行。非常適合粘貼代碼或撰寫詳細提示。

中斷 Agent

如果 Agent 運行時間過長,只需輸入新消息並按 Enter——它將中斷當前任務並切換到你的新指令。Ctrl+C 也有效。

恢復會話

退出時,hermes 會打印出恢復命令:

hermes --continue    # 恢復最近一次會話
hermes -c # 簡寫形式

5. 進一步探索

以下是一些你可以嘗試的進階操作:

設置沙箱終端

為確保安全,建議在 Docker 容器或遠程服務器上運行 Agent:

hermes config set terminal.backend docker    # 使用 Docker 隔離終端
hermes config set terminal.backend ssh # 把終端切到遠程服務器

連接消息平臺

通過微信、飛書、電報、Discord、WhatsApp、Signal、電子郵件或 Home Assistant 從手機或其他設備與 Hermes 對話:

hermes gateway setup    # 交互式配置消息平臺

添加語音模式

希望在 CLI 中使用麥克風輸入,或在消息中獲得語音回覆?

pip install "hermes-agent[voice]"

# 可選,但推薦:啟用免費的本地語音轉文字
pip install faster-whisper

然後啟動 Hermes 並在 CLI 中啟用語音模式:

/voice on

Ctrl+B 開始錄音,或使用 /voice tts 讓 Hermes 朗讀其回覆。完整設置請參見 語音模式,涵蓋 CLI、Telegram、Discord 及 Discord 語音頻道。

安排自動化任務

❯ 每天早上 9 點檢查 Hacker News 上的 AI 新聞,並通過電報給我發一份摘要。

Agent 將通過網關自動設置一個 cron 任務,定時運行。

瀏覽並安裝技能

hermes skills search kubernetes
hermes skills search react --source skills-sh
hermes skills search https://mintlify.com/docs --source well-known
hermes skills install openai/skills/k8s
hermes skills install official/security/1password
hermes skills install skills-sh/vercel-labs/json-render/json-render-react --force

提示:

  • 使用 --source skills-sh 搜索公共的 skills.sh 目錄。
  • 使用 --source well-known 並配合文檔/網站 URL,從 /.well-known/skills/index.json 發現技能。
  • 僅在審查第三方技能後使用 --force。它可覆蓋非危險策略塊,但無法覆蓋 dangerous 掃描結論。

也可在聊天中使用 /skills 斜槓命令。

通過 ACP 在編輯器中使用 Hermes

Hermes 還可作為 ACP 服務器運行,兼容 VS Code、Zed 和 JetBrains 等 ACP 編輯器:

pip install -e '.[acp]'
hermes acp

有關設置詳情,請參閱 ACP 編輯器集成

嘗試 MCP 服務器

通過模型上下文協議(Model Context Protocol)連接外部工具:

# 添加到 ~/.hermes/config.yaml
mcp_servers:
github:
command: npx
args: ["-y", "@modelcontextprotocol/server-github"]
env:
GITHUB_PERSONAL_ACCESS_TOKEN: "ghp_xxx"

快速參考

命令描述
hermes開始聊天
hermes model選擇你的大語言模型(LLM)提供商和模型
hermes tools配置各平臺啟用的工具
hermes setup完整設置嚮導(一次性配置所有內容)
hermes doctor診斷問題
hermes update更新至最新版本
hermes gateway啟動消息網關
hermes --continue恢復上次會話

下一步